Sri Lanka batter Lahiru Thirimanne announces retirement from international cricket

  • Sri Lanka batter Lahiru Thirimanne has announced his retirement from international cricket after a 13-year career. 
  • The 33-year-old top-order batter made his international debut in 2010 and went on to represent Sri Lanka in 44 Tests, 127 ODIs, and 26 T20Is.
  • The 33-year-old featured in 197 international matches for Sri Lanka and scored 5573 runs with seven hundred and 31 fifties.
  • He featured in two ODI World Cups and three T20 World Cup campaigns, including Sri Lanka's victory in 2014. In five ODIs, he also served as Sri Lanka's captain.
  • Thirimanne's last match for Sri Lanka came in the second Test against India at Bengaluru in March last year where he fell cheaply for eight and zero.
